    • Obituary: 25 Oct 2021; Anthony J. "Tony" Truchinskas ATHOL, MA — Anthony (Tony) Truchinskas, 79, died early on Saturday, October 23, 2021 at his daughter Paula's home in the loving presence of his family. The son of Joseph and Pauline (Vaitekunas) Truchinskas, Tony was born in Athol, MA on September 28, 1942 and lived there for his entire life. He was baptized and confirmed at St. Francis of Assisi Catholic Parish. After graduating from Athol High School in 1960, he worked at Tyler Millwork Co. before joining the Toolmaker Apprentice Program at the L.S. Starrett Co. at age 19. While completing the apprentice program, he attended Mount Wachusett Community College to earn his Associates Degree in Mechanical Engineering. He went on to work at Starrett's for 46 years, retiring at age 64 after having been foreman of the Tool Room for several years. While raising his family, Tony also worked side jobs as a gas station attendant and then as a bartender at Omer's Restaurant. Tony enjoyed playing softball, ice hockey, fishing and hunting before activities were curtailed by severe rheumatoid arthritis. After that, he enjoyed his spectator sports, watching the Red Sox, Patriots and NASCAR racing. He was a lifetime member of the American Lithuanian Naturalization Club, eventually becoming president. He also rose through the chairs of the Benevolent Protective Order of the Elks to become the Exalted Ruler. He especially enjoyed activities through the Elks that supported students and the community. Tony was predeceased by his parents, Joseph and Pauline Truchinskas, and his daughter, Karen Truchinskas.
